Read moreWe have utilized Moxie for a few years now and never really had any problems....until now. We purchased the termite system for $1,800 about three years ago. They are supposed to come out once a year and check everything and replace the bait as needed, for an extra $300 a year. Last year we fell for this and they came out and "checked everything" but didn't replace anything. This year they wanted to come out again and "check". After initially telling them no, they agreed to lower the price to $200 and agreed they would replace all of the bait regardless of if it needed to be or not. The guy came out and said he would check everything and when asked to be sure to replace all the bait as agreed upon by the company, he said oh no we don't do that, the bait is good for 10 years. So clearly they are running a scam. Charging you almost $2000 to get the system and then $300 a year to "check everything" aka do nothing really. The guy reluctantly agreed but 10 minutes later knocked on our door and said he didn't have the equipment necessary to find our bait boxes. The same ones THEY installed. He said someone else would have to come back out to complete the service. Several weeks went by and nothing. Finally someone calls and tries to schedule a repeat service. We had enough and told them we didn't want the system anymore. They were quick to point out that their service agreement said they owned the system and would have to come remove it. While they were not so eager to provide services any other time, they certainly scheduled the removal of our system rather quicky. Bottom line, don't fall for the termite control system, it is just a money maker for them. Not too thrilled with their customer service in regular pest control services either.
